In 1893, Bernice Christina Kendall entered the world in Leominster, Worcester, Massachusetts, born to Edward Josephus Kendall And Fannie Henrietta Nutting. In 1900, Bernice Christina Kendall resided in Leominster, Worcester, Massachusetts. In 1910, Bernice Christina Kendall resided in Sterling, Worcester, Massachusetts. Bernice Christina Kendall married Herbert Parker Sweet Sr, and had children including Donald P Sweet, Grace C Sweet, Herbert Parker Sweet Jr. Bernice Christina Kendall passed away in 1968 in Pepperell, Middlesex, Massachusetts.
